Abstract

The development of high rise building in Surabaya growth rapidly. Unfortunately the development of high-rise buildings mainly focused on market preferences and surface soil rather than the underground condition. By referring to this condition, several areas in Surabaya has a high intensity ground vibrations due to an earthquake. The results of this study is then reprocessed and continued to be overlaid withthe finding of developers preference using a combined method of Analytical Hierarchy Process (AHP) and Geographic Information System (GIS).From the standpoint of physical analysis, which focuses on the risks of earthquake and the need to meet market demands such as land availability, infrastructure, and market size so it is necessary to produce suitability map for high-rise buildings which are safe and profitable according to comprehensive study. The results of this study are expected to be beneficial for government to create a policy high rise building zone based on the spatial aspect, the physical aspect as well as the preference of developers to municipalities.
